In learning as in anything else, the best way to learn is to practice; if you don't actually have experience in doing it, you probably won't be able to do it at all. My function, then, is simply that of a coach. If you find yourself having trouble in learning something, I'm here to guide you. I'll put you through exercises and, if necessary, come up with a regimen for you. Hopefully, you won't need me too much, but if you're struggling and you find yourself in need of assistance, I am here for you.

I got my Bachelor's in Political Science from Stony Brook, and I got my Master's in Political Science from Columbia. I don't have much experience at the moment, but I have had successful sessions with 3-4 students, and I am able to explain things to people and remain calm in doing so. I tutor math (up to Calc I), English (up to AP-level), Spanish (up to AP-level), Physics (Regents-level), German (up to intermediate), French, Latin (both elementary), and the SATs and GREs. Of the subjects I've tutored so far, I'd say math is my favorite because it is highly objective and it comes very naturally to me. My interests outside of academics include music, playing music, and, obviously, politics (don't worry, I'm not a nut).
